## Local Setup

Farebranch runs the ticket-pricing experiment service for Velodrome Transit. Clone the repo, install deps with `make bootstrap`, and copy `config.sample.toml` to `config.local.toml`. The experiment allocator requires Postgres 15; seed data lives in `fixtures/pricing_buckets.sql`. No external calls are made in local mode — the fare oracle is stubbed. TLS is disabled locally by design; flag anything that changes that. The allocator reads its database connection from the line below.

primary connection of fahag-kawig = mysql://gilath_svc:ycU1T0imceeaI4@db-27dd.norvastack.example:5432/silwyn

**Mgmt Meeting Minutes — Retiring the Brightline Range**

Quick recap for sales leads at Fenholt Supplies: we agreed to retire the Brightline fixture range by year-end. Remaining stock moves to clearance pricing next month, and accounts on standing orders get migrated to the Lumetta range. Trade-in incentives were approved in principle. The confidential note on next steps sits just below.

board note of bajof-bajeg: The pricing group signed off on a budget of $13.4 million for Project Sildor. The renewal with Lamixek Holdings closes at $48.9 million a year, 49 percent above the last contract.

## Payroll Export Format Change — review notes

Heads up: the Ledgerline payroll export moved from fixed-width to signed JSON bundles as of the Q3 release. The old format is fully retired, so nothing downstream should be parsing column offsets anymore. From a security angle, the main change is that bundles are now encrypted at rest before the courier job picks them up, and the signing key rotates monthly. For your review, the export service currently runs with the following configuration values.

deployment values, yadug-bawif:
[framir]
team = pelox
access_code = ac_a38ab2
owner = tamion.julael
host = framir.tolvaqlabs.test
port = 11211
peer = tammir.zemvargrid.local
salt = 2215ef03
pin = 1541

## Service accounts and the clock-skew saga

Quick context for reviewers: the Dovetail build agents drift badly (we've seen 90 seconds), and skewed clocks make the Harrowby token validator reject perfectly good service-account tokens. So we widened the validation window and added an NTP check to agent startup. The `dovetail-ci` service account talks to Harrowby using the key right below.

service key, yadug-bajog: zpat3_pou